MCP Universal Manager
Overview
Comprehensive MCP (Model Context Protocol) server management system that automatically discovers, monitors, and manages MCP servers across multiple AI platforms with real-time health monitoring and automated troubleshooting capabilities.
Prerequisites
- Access to AI platforms (Claude Code, Factory Droid, etc.)
- MCP server configuration files or directories
- Network connectivity to target platforms
- Appropriate permissions for server management
What This Skill Does
- Auto-Discovery: Automatically finds MCP servers across platforms
- Health Monitoring: Real-time monitoring of server status and performance
- Quality Scoring: Quality assessment of MCP server implementations
- Troubleshooting: Automated diagnosis and repair of common issues
- Synchronization: Cross-platform server state synchronization
- Security Monitoring: Security audit and vulnerability scanning

Configuration
Platform Configuration
Edit resources/platform-config.json:
{
"platforms": {
"claude-code": {
"config_path": "~/.config/claude/claude_desktop_config.json",
"enabled": true,
"auto_discovery": true
},
"factory-droid": {
"config_path": "~/.factory/droids/",
"repo_scan": true,
"enabled": true
},
"antigravity": {
"config_path": "~/.antigravity/scripts/",
"enabled": true
},
"gemini": {
"config_path": "~/Library/Application Support/Google/Chrome/Profile 1/Extensions/",
"enabled": false
}
},
"custom_locations": [
"/opt/mcp-servers/",
"~/projects/mcp/"
]
}
Monitoring Settings
{
"health_check_interval": "60s",
"performance_threshold": {
"response_time": "2000ms",
"success_rate": "95%",
"memory_usage": "512MB"
},
"alert_settings": {
"email": "admin@company.com",
"slack_webhook": "https://hooks.slack.com/...",
"severity_threshold": "medium"
}
}

Step 1.2: Server Classification
Each discovered server is classified by:
- Type: Database, API, File system, AI model, Custom
- Complexity: Simple, Intermediate, Advanced
- Dependencies: Required services and libraries
- Security Level: Public, Private, Sensitive

Step 2.2: Quality Scoring System
MCP Manager calculates quality scores based on:
- Performance: Response times and throughput
- Reliability: Uptime and error rates
- Security: Authentication, encryption, access controls
- Documentation: API docs, examples, README quality
- Maintenance: Update frequency and issue resolution

Troubleshooting
Issue: Server Discovery Failures
Symptoms: Known servers not discovered by scan Solution:
- Check
resources/platform-config.jsonfor correct paths - Verify file permissions and access rights
- Run
./scripts/debug-discovery.shfor detailed diagnosis - Add custom server locations manually to configuration
Issue: False Positives in Health Monitoring
Symptoms: Healthy servers flagged as unhealthy Solution:
- Adjust performance thresholds in configuration
- Review timeout settings for slower servers
- Exclude intermittent issues from alerting
- Implement grace periods for temporary failures
Issue: Cross-Platform Authentication Errors
Symptoms: Authentication fails when synchronizing platforms Solution:
- Verify authentication tokens are current
- Check platform-specific API access permissions
- Review token expiration and renewal policies
- Use
./scripts/refresh-auth.shto update credentials
